What can I see and do near National Etruscan Museum?
Vatican Museums, Borghese Gallery and MAXXI - National Museum of the 21st Century feature a variety of fascinating exhibits to see while you're in town. Spanish Steps, Trevi Fountain and Piazza Navona are some of the local landmarks to explore. You can catch a show at Auditorium Parco della Musica, Olimpico Theater and Sistina Theater.
How can I get to National Etruscan Museum?
With so many ways to get around, seeing the area around National Etruscan Museum is simple. Nearby metro stations include Aldrovandi Tram Stop, Galleria Arte Moderna Tram Stop and Bioparco Tram Stop. If you're taking a train into town, Rome Euclide Station and Rome Piazzale Flaminio Station are the closest stops to Pinciano.
